Guest : 방문자
Reporter : 보고자
Developer : 개발자
Master : 마스터 관리자
Owner : 소유자
Leader : 리더
Edit :
Collaborate : 담당자에 할당은 안되지만, 쓰기/읽기/수정이 가능함.
Read&Analyze : 담당자에 할당은 안되지만, 조회만 가능하고 수정이 가능함.
방문자 :
새 이슈를 생성하고 코멘트를 남길 수 있다.
코드에 대한 접근 권한이 필요 없다. 코드를 확인 할 수 없어야 한다.(보안상)
프로젝트 개발에 관여해야 하는 당사자에게 적절하다.
보고자
방문자의 권한 외에도 추가로 보고자는 프로젝트를 복제하고 코드조각을 생성할 권한을 갖는다.
개발자
보고자의 권한에 추가로 개발자는 새 브랜치를 생성, 병합요청, 보호되지 않는 브랜치에
Push 하고 태그를 추가, 위키페이지를 작성, 이슈추적기를 관리하는 등의 권한이 있다.
대부분의 팀원은 이 역할을 할당 받을 것이다.
마스터
개발자의 권한에 추가로 마스터는 마일스톤을 생성, 새팀원 추가, 보호 브랜치에 Push, 배포키로 제춤에 추가, 프로젝트 자체를 수정할 수 있어야 한다.
이 역할은 팀 리더에게 부여하는 것이 적절하다.
때대로 팀의 구성/접근 권한을 변경해야 하는 요령 있는 PM에게도 이 역할을 부여 할 수 있을 것이다.
소유자
기존 권한에 더 해 프로젝트 공개 수준을 변경하고,
프로젝트를 다른 네임스페이스로 이전, 프로젝트를 삭제 할수 있다.
팀원이 아닌 관리자가 이역할을 갖는 것이 적절하다.
Add Comment